Roy's at Pebble Beach

Roy's at Pebble Beach is located inside the Spanish Bay Hotel and offers delicious Hawaiian-fusion cuisine.  Nearly every table at Roy's has a view and the fun, dynamic atmosphere adds to the dining experience.  We first dined at Roy's about 12 years ago in Maui and were thrilled to learn that there was a Roy's located on the Monterey Peninsula.  My favorite entrees include the delightful Honey Mustard Beef Short Ribs, Blackened Rare Ahi and the Day Boat Scallops (when available).  However, I will often order two or three appetizers in place of an entree when I'm in the mood to mix and match.  The Blackened Ahi and the "Dynamite" Day Boat Scallops are also offered on the appetizer menu along with some of my other favorites that include the Szechwan BBQ Baby Back Ribs and the sumptuous Lobster and Shrimp Dumplings.  The portions are very generous and have a delicate balance of color and flavor.  If you arrive at sunset you can catch the professional bagpiper play wonderful Celtic music outdoors.
